Description

Akulon® is our family of high performance polyamide 6 and polyamide 66 materials, used by customers across the world in applications ranging from automotive, electronics & electrical, to furniture and packaging.
We offer Akulon® grades for injection molding, blow molding and extrusion (including barrier film, stock shapes, convoluted tubes, and mono and multi filament).
In molded parts the material offers an excellent balance of easy design and processing with outstanding mechanical properties over a wide temperature range and in diverse conditions. Meanwhile for extrusion the strength, resilience and easy processing of Akulon® sets the market standards.

Technological properties

Property
Application areas

Chainsaw housings, Chair Bases, Chair Arms, Chair Frames, Powertool Housings, Wheel Chair Rims, Railway Insulation Plates, Rear Grips, Wheels, Structural Reinforcements

Certifications

Yellow Card Available

Fillers

30% Glass Fiber
